Output aa72b773668ed633aba6a135d09391e604a8df9a201e006c3312ebf5bcd30598:0

value
254518860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acfb5a4668cb9906ca6d88ef1a9e4ca4b2e4beb3 OP_EQUAL
address
MPfoZiGmDs7sT1X5QKvr5U8V3S4hLoqDKW
transaction
aa72b773668ed633aba6a135d09391e604a8df9a201e006c3312ebf5bcd30598
spent
true